大数据存储数据库是什么

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    大数据存储数据库是一种专门用于存储、管理和处理大规模数据的数据库系统。它们被设计用于处理海量数据,包括结构化数据(如关系型数据)和非结构化数据(如文本、图像、音频和视频等)。这些数据库系统采用了特定的存储和处理技术,以满足大数据处理的需求。

    以下是大数据存储数据库的一些关键特点和功能:

    1. 分布式存储:大数据存储数据库使用分布式存储技术,将数据分散存储在多个节点上。这样可以实现数据的高可用性和容错性,并支持横向扩展,以应对数据量的增加。

    2. 高性能处理:大数据存储数据库能够并行处理大规模数据,具有快速的数据读写速度和高效的查询性能。它们使用了一些优化技术,如数据压缩、索引、预取和缓存等,以提高数据处理的效率。

    3. 弹性扩展:大数据存储数据库可以根据需要进行弹性扩展,即可以根据数据量和负载的增加来增加存储和计算资源。这种扩展性使得数据库能够适应不断增长的数据需求,而无需进行大规模的硬件升级。

    4. 多模型支持:大数据存储数据库支持多种数据模型,如关系型、文档型、列式和图形等。这使得它们能够存储和处理不同类型的数据,满足不同应用场景的需求。

    5. 数据分析和挖掘:大数据存储数据库提供了强大的数据分析和挖掘功能,包括数据聚合、统计分析、机器学习和数据可视化等。这些功能可以帮助用户从海量数据中发现有价值的信息和模式,支持数据驱动的决策和业务创新。

    综上所述,大数据存储数据库是一种专门用于存储和处理大规模数据的数据库系统,具有分布式存储、高性能处理、弹性扩展、多模型支持和数据分析等功能。它们在大数据时代中发挥着重要的作用,帮助企业和组织处理和利用海量数据,实现数据驱动的业务价值。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    大数据存储数据库是指用于存储和管理大规模数据的数据库系统。随着互联网的迅速发展和各种传感器、设备的广泛应用,大数据的产生量急剧增加,传统的关系型数据库已经无法满足大数据处理的需求。因此,大数据存储数据库应运而生。

    大数据存储数据库有以下几个主要特点:

    1. 分布式存储:大数据存储数据库采用分布式存储的方式,将数据分散存储在多个节点上,每个节点负责存储和处理一部分数据。这样可以提高数据的存储和处理效率,并且具有良好的可扩展性。

    2. 高可靠性:大数据存储数据库通常采用冗余备份的方式来保证数据的高可靠性。即使某个节点出现故障,系统仍然可以正常运行,不会丢失数据。

    3. 高性能:大数据存储数据库具有较高的读写性能,能够快速处理大规模数据。它采用了一系列的优化技术,如数据压缩、索引优化、并行计算等,来提高数据库的性能。

    4. 支持海量数据:大数据存储数据库能够支持海量数据的存储和查询。它可以存储PB级别的数据,并且能够在短时间内完成复杂的查询操作。

    5. 支持多种数据类型:大数据存储数据库不仅支持结构化数据,还支持半结构化和非结构化数据。它可以存储和处理各种类型的数据,如文本、图片、音频、视频等。

    目前市场上主流的大数据存储数据库包括Hadoop、Cassandra、MongoDB、HBase等。它们都具有较高的性能和可扩展性,能够满足大数据处理的需求。同时,随着大数据技术的不断发展,未来还会有更多的大数据存储数据库出现。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    大数据存储数据库是一种专门用于存储和管理大规模数据的数据库系统。与传统关系型数据库不同,大数据存储数据库具有高可扩展性、高性能和高可用性的特点,能够处理海量数据,并能够支持并行计算和分布式存储。

    大数据存储数据库通常采用分布式架构,将数据分散存储在多个节点上,通过并行计算来提高查询和分析的速度。它们通常使用横向扩展的方式来增加存储和计算能力,可以通过添加新的节点来扩展系统的规模。

    下面将从方法、操作流程等方面详细介绍大数据存储数据库。

    一、大数据存储数据库的方法

    1. 列存储方法:列存储是大数据存储数据库的一种常见方法,它将数据按列存储,而不是按行存储。这种方法在处理大规模数据时具有很高的效率,因为它可以只读取需要的列,而不必读取整个表。

    2. 分布式存储方法:大数据存储数据库通常采用分布式存储方法,将数据分散存储在多个节点上。这种方法可以提高存储的容量和性能,并且可以通过添加新的节点来扩展存储能力。

    3. 压缩方法:为了减少存储空间和提高数据传输效率,大数据存储数据库通常使用压缩方法对数据进行压缩。压缩方法可以将数据压缩成更小的存储空间,从而节省存储成本。

    二、大数据存储数据库的操作流程

    1. 数据采集:在大数据存储数据库中,首先需要进行数据采集。数据采集可以通过多种方式进行,例如通过传感器、日志文件、数据库等。采集到的数据可以是结构化、半结构化或非结构化的数据。

    2. 数据清洗:采集到的数据通常包含噪声和错误,需要进行数据清洗。数据清洗可以通过去除重复数据、填充缺失值、纠正错误等方式进行。

    3. 数据存储:清洗后的数据需要存储在大数据存储数据库中。数据存储可以采用列存储或分布式存储的方式进行。存储时需要考虑数据的分区和索引,以便提高查询效率。

    4. 数据处理:存储在大数据存储数据库中的数据可以进行各种数据处理操作,例如数据分析、数据挖掘、机器学习等。数据处理可以通过并行计算的方式进行,从而提高处理速度。

    5. 数据查询:在大数据存储数据库中,可以通过查询语言进行数据查询。查询语言可以是结构化查询语言(SQL)或其他自定义查询语言。查询结果可以根据需要进行可视化或导出。

    6. 数据管理:大数据存储数据库需要进行数据管理,包括数据备份、数据迁移、数据恢复等。数据管理可以通过自动化工具进行,以减少人工操作和降低管理成本。

    总结起来,大数据存储数据库是一种专门用于存储和管理大规模数据的数据库系统。它具有高可扩展性、高性能和高可用性的特点,采用分布式存储和并行计算的方式处理海量数据。通过数据采集、清洗、存储、处理、查询和管理等操作流程,可以实现对大数据的存储、分析和应用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部